body {
margin: 10px 30px 20px 30px;
background: #000;		
}


A  { color: #fff; text-decoration: underline; }
A:link { color: #fff; text-decoration: underline; }
A:visited { color: #eee; text-decoration: underline; }
A:active { color: #ff0000;  }
A:hover { color: #ff0000;  }


#banner {
color: #999;
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: 33px;
text-decoration: none;
letter-spacing: 5px;
font-weight: normal;
}

#banner a:link, #banner a:visited {
color: #999;
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: 33px;
text-decoration: none;
letter-spacing: 5px;
font-weight: normal;
}

#banner a:hover {
color: #ccc;
}

#heading {
color: #999;
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: 20px;
text-decoration: none;
letter-spacing: 5px;
font-weight: normal;
}

#entry {
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: small;
color: #fff;
padding: 0px 0px 20px 5px;
width: 350px;
}

.header {
color: #999;
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: small;
font-weight: bold;
border-bottom: 1px solid #999;
padding-bottom: 10px;
}

p {
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: small;
color: #eee;
text-decoration: none;
line-height: 150%;
}


#comments {
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: small;
color: #999;
padding: 0px 30px 10px 30px;
width: 300px;
}

#comments p {
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: small;
color: #999;
text-decoration: none;
}

#comments A  { text-decoration: underline; }
A:link { color: #999; }
A:visited { color: #666; }
A:active { color: #eee;  }
A:hover { color: #eee;  }

.comment {
border-bottom: 1px solid #999;
}



#calendar {
color: #999;
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: small;
font-weight: bold;
}

#calendar .label {
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: small;
color: #fff;
background-color: #000;
letter-spacing: 2px;
text-transform: uppercase;
border-top: 1px solid #000;
border-bottom: 1px solid #DCDCDC;
border-left: 1px solid #000;
border-right: 1px solid #DCDCDC;
text-align: center;
}

#calendar .header {
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: 11px;
color: #999;
background-color: #000;
}

#calendar a {
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: small;
text-decoration: none;
font-weight: bold;
}

#calendar a:link, #calendar a:visited {
color: #fff;
}

#calendar a:active, #calendar a:hover {
color: #666;
}

.form {
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: small;
border: 1px solid #999;
background-color: #000;
color: #eee;
}

.button {
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: small;
border: 1px solid #999;
background-color: #000;
color: #eee;
}


.click {
font-family: verdana, arial, sans-serif, palatino,  georgia;
font-size: 9px;
}
